Italo is a brand of high-speed trains operated by the Italian train company Nuovo Trasporto Viaggiatori (NTV). Its fleet includes the Italo AGV 575, the premier high-speed service reaching speeds up to 186 mph (300 km/h), and the Italo EVO, an eco-friendly #[+travelMode] that can reach a maximum speed of 150 mph (250 km/h). Italo offers four different class options, but each car is modernly equipped with a high level of comfort. You can choose between the Smart, Comfort, Prima and Club Executive classes. Italo offers three types of fares with different prices and flexibility: Low Cost, Economy, and Flex.
